One thing , we have done, our entire HS journey, has been fun Fridays! We focus a lot more on interest led topics, playing educational games , baking , educational tv shows/movies , etc . As the kids got older, we were all reading different books , of our own choice . We had a “ book club”, where we would sit & drink decaf coffee or tea & share with one another what we liked & disliked about our books . This worked great if we were all reading the same book as well, but I discovered, it’s still so much fun when we are reading different books! We also had days where we would each get an encyclopedia , pick something random to read about, & share with each other . I think I need to start our “ book club “ & encyclopedia days, back up again!! 😊 It’s the most rewarding thing in the world, to get to bond with your kids ! To break up the monotony, sometimes, one of the kids will do the teaching on a subject ! That is really fun ! 😀
